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_001039372.4(HEPACAM2):​c.530G>A​(p.Arg177Gln) variant causes a missense change. The variant allele was found at a frequency of 0.00000479 in 1,461,566 control chromosomes in the GnomAD database, with no homozygous occurrence.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
HEPACAM2 (HGNC:27364): (HEPACAM family member 2) This gene encodes a protein related to the immunoglobulin superfamily that plays a role in mitosis. Knockdown of this gene results in prometaphase arrest, abnormal nuclear morphology and apoptosis. Poly(ADP-ribosylation) of the encoded protein promotes its translocation to centrosomes, which may stimulate centrosome maturation. A chromosomal deletion including this gene may be associated with myeloid leukemia and myelodysplastic syndrome in human patients. [provided by RefSeq, Oct 2016]
